Location: Cupertino, CA (Fully Onsite)
Duration: 12 Months
Team Overview:
The Stores Business Planning Team drives alignment across Client ’s Global Retail Support functions—commercial, people, training, and store operations—through a unified business plan, capacity plan, and planning process. The team ensures effective prioritization, sequencing, and execution of initiatives that impact retail stores worldwide.
Role Summary:
The Planning Manager will play a role in supporting the global sequencing, prioritization, and capacity planning processes for Client’s Retail Stores. This position will synthesize inputs from multiple global business partners, build a cohesive quarterly and annual plan of record, and assess capacity implications for field teams.
The ideal candidate is a structured thinker, exceptional communicator, and experienced planner who thrives in ambiguity and can translate complex initiatives into actionable business plans.
Key Responsibilities:
Planning & Coordination
- Support the intake of quarterly global programs, projects, and initiatives impacting Client Retail Stores.
- Build and maintain a single, integrated Stores Plan of Record that aligns initiatives across global partners.
- Support annual and quarterly planning cycles, aligning resources, timelines, and priorities across all regions.
- Act as a liaison between Global Retail Support teams, field partners, and cross-functional stakeholders.
- Facilitate ongoing communication, reports, business updates, and alignment sessions with global business partners.
- Ensure transparency and visibility of initiative sequencing, dependencies, and milestones.
- Identify and analyze trends across programs to drive data-informed prioritization.
- Provide executive-ready summaries, dashboards, and reports to support strategic decision-making.
- Anticipate and resolve conflicts, manage dependencies, and mitigate risks to delivery timelines.
Key Qualifications:
Industry & Functional Expertise
- Deep understanding of the retail industry, store operations, and omnichannel commerce trends.
- Strong business acumen and ability to understand all aspects of retail store execution (e.g., people, customer experience, training, merchandising, operations).
- Experience in strategic planning, program management, or retail business operations.
- Proven ability to lead cross-functional collaboration without direct authority.
- Exceptional influencer who connects dots between teams, builds alignment, and drives results.
- Strong ability to synthesize complex information, identify key insights, and distinguish signal from noise.
- Excellent communicator who can present complex plans simply and persuasively.
- Builds strong networks across functions, geographies, and organizational levels.
- 8+ years of experience in retail business planning, operations, or program management (global experience preferred).
- Experience working in a large matrixed organization, ideally within technology or premium retail.
- Proficiency with planning tools and dashboards (e.g., Excel, Keynote, Numbers, Smartsheet, or equivalent).
- Experience with data visualization and capacity modeling is a plus.
